The Opuszczony basen na terenie AON, once a vibrant hub, now stands silent. It’s a poignant reminder of the ever-shifting tides of history. The pool itself was built around 1936. Architects Romuald Gutt and Aleksander Sznolis designed the pool and changing rooms. Imagine the laughter and splashes echoing across the grounds. The original complex included the open-air pool and sanitary facilities with showers.
After the upheaval of World War II, the Opuszczony basen na terenie AON was lengthened. It served the residents of the military housing complex. Unofficially, it was also a popular spot for the rest of Rembertów. This continued for many years. The pool became a community gathering place. It provided a welcome respite from the summer heat. After 1989, there was a push to transform the area into a full-fledged recreation center. However, this dream never materialized.
The Opuszczony basen na terenie AON is located on the grounds of what was once the National Defence University of Warsaw (Akademia Obrony Narodowej or AON). This institution has a rich history. It traces its roots back to the Szkoła Rycerska (School of Knights), founded in 1765 by King Stanisław August Poniatowski. The AON itself was established in 1990, succeeding the General Staff Academy. The university offered a wide array of programs. These included studies in national security, economics, logistics, management, and history. It also hosted advanced courses for military personnel and postgraduate studies for civilians.
Interestingly, before World War II, a grotto containing a statue of the Virgin Mary stood near the Opuszczony basen na terenie AON. It served as a quiet place for reflection. This detail adds another layer to the complex history of this site. After the war, however, the statue was removed. The reasons behind its removal remain a mystery.
